Prosecheck is the linter that runs against every Markdown file in the Hallowmere docs repo. It flags broken cross-references, stale version strings, and heading-depth violations, and it blocks merges on errors. Rule definitions and suppression records are stored centrally rather than in the repo, so edits to rules take effect for all branches immediately. For the weekly eng sync, the relevant metric is the suppression count, which you can query directly against the rules database via the connection string below.

warehouse DSN: mssql://rusdor_svc:0FSWCn9@db-951a.paliqforge.local:5432/ulawyn

Welcome to the Lattice Atlas team. As release manager, you own the dependency graph visualizer's release pipeline and its sealed signing store. Tag cuts happen Tuesdays; the graph snapshot must be regenerated before each cut. If the signing store is sealed after a pipeline restart, unseal it yourself using the recovery passphrase provided immediately below.

unlock words, tagaf-hahif: ralwyn-lammir-rusax-sormir

## Ownership

The dedup pipeline (Mergewell) owns all customer-record matching and merge logic. Do not ship releases that alter match thresholds without a dry-run report attached. Merge conflicts between golden records are resolved by the pipeline, never by hand edits in the downstream store. Rollbacks require the last known-good snapshot tag. All schema changes to the match-key table go through the ownership review queue. Release manager: block any build lacking sign-off. The accountable owner for this component is named below.

account owner for fajep-yagef: Kasix Eliiel